Transaction 6ee93c31385fbe717957720605cf168e70eec2e280320d721d247f57414d7110
1 Input
2 Outputs
- 6ee93c31385fbe717957720605cf168e70eec2e280320d721d247f57414d7110:0
- 6ee93c31385fbe717957720605cf168e70eec2e280320d721d247f57414d7110:1
value 335933
address 3PMfwUYHsZyGDxrNaESnUrAo58PN6GL4gD
value 1230841
address 12vmy7SgN4YhNe6ZVehaM94EZ4VCxoePTU